需要澄清一些基本的HDFS术语

时间:2016-07-16 22:55:42

标签: hadoop hdfs terminology

什么是图像,检查点,什么是期刊?

在我读过的一个博客中(链接:http://www.aosabook.org/en/hdfs.html),它说HDFS中的图像是“inode和定义名称系统元数据的块列表”;我不确定这句话是什么意思......

他们还解释说“checkpoint”是“存储在NameNode的本地本机文件系统中的图像的持久记录”;在这个陈述中,什么是“持久记录”?

期刊如何与这两个概念相关?

提前感谢您的帮助!

1 个答案:

答案 0 :(得分:0)

  

什么是图像,检查点,什么是期刊?

在该链接上非常清楚地描述了......

  

文件和目录在NameNode上由 inodes 表示。 Inodes 记录属性,如权限,修改和访问时间,命名空间和磁盘空间配额。

     

inodes 以及定义名称系统元数据的块列表称为图像。 [...]存储在NameNode的本地本机文件系统中的图像的持久记录称为检查点

     

NameNode在名为日记 的预写日志中记录对HDFS的更改

至于你的其他问题

  

" inode和定义名称系统元数据的块列表&#34 ;;我不确定这句话是什么意思......

如果您阅读了Inode(和块)的内容,那么图像就是定义名称系统元数据的inode和块的集合......实际上没有其他方法可以描述它。也许您需要查找元数据的定义?

  

什么是指"持续记录"?

查找持久性的定义。检查站是一个"快照"在HDFS上存储的特定时间点的图像。

  

期刊如何与这两个概念相关?

日记记录HDFS的所有更改。编写图像和检查点的过程会对HDFS进行更改